Compare commits
No commits in common. "22e4294469658de9fa3592c7fe8955f77ea00dc1" and "bd2af92ec9dc6825735f18e365bdbdf2a42b15f5" have entirely different histories.
22e4294469
...
bd2af92ec9
1 changed files with 3 additions and 7 deletions
10
discorss.py
10
discorss.py
|
|
@ -24,10 +24,10 @@ log_file_name = r"/app.log"
|
||||||
def getDescription(feed):
|
def getDescription(feed):
|
||||||
try:
|
try:
|
||||||
tempStr = str(feed.entries[0]["summary_detail"]["value"])
|
tempStr = str(feed.entries[0]["summary_detail"]["value"])
|
||||||
desc = tempStr[:150] if len(tempStr) > 150 else tempStr
|
desc = tempStr[:100] if len(tempStr) > 100 else tempStr
|
||||||
except KeyError:
|
except KeyError:
|
||||||
tempStr = str(feed.entries[0]["description"])
|
tempStr = str(feed.entries[0]["description"])
|
||||||
desc = tempStr[:150] if len(tempStr) > 150 else tempStr
|
desc = tempStr[:100] if len(tempStr) > 100 else tempStr
|
||||||
return desc
|
return desc
|
||||||
|
|
||||||
|
|
||||||
|
|
@ -54,16 +54,12 @@ def main():
|
||||||
print(feed.entries[0]["published"], published_time, now)
|
print(feed.entries[0]["published"], published_time, now)
|
||||||
# Generate the webhook
|
# Generate the webhook
|
||||||
webhook = {
|
webhook = {
|
||||||
|
"content": "RSS Feed Update from " + str(hook["name"]),
|
||||||
"embeds": [
|
"embeds": [
|
||||||
{
|
{
|
||||||
"title": str(feed.entries[0]["title"]),
|
"title": str(feed.entries[0]["title"]),
|
||||||
"url": str(feed.entries[0]["link"]),
|
"url": str(feed.entries[0]["link"]),
|
||||||
"color": 5814783,
|
"color": 5814783,
|
||||||
"provider": {
|
|
||||||
"name": "DiscoRSS",
|
|
||||||
"url": "https://git.frzn.dev/amr/discorss",
|
|
||||||
},
|
|
||||||
"author": {"name": str(hook["name"]), "url": str(hook["siteurl"])},
|
|
||||||
"fields": [
|
"fields": [
|
||||||
{
|
{
|
||||||
"name": str(feed.entries[0]["title"]),
|
"name": str(feed.entries[0]["title"]),
|
||||||
|
|
|
||||||
Loading…
Add table
Add a link
Reference in a new issue